Residential Roof Replacement in Worcester, MA
Residential ro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new roofing system to ensure the property's protection and aesthetic appeal. These projects typically address issues such as extensive damage from weather, aging materials, or the need for an upgraded appearance. Hom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the replacement, including the types of roofing materials available, the expected lifespan of the new roof, and any preparations needed before work begins. Clarifying these details helps property owners make informed decisions about their roofing investments.
Before requesting roof replacement services, property owners should consider the current condition of their roof, including signs of damage like leaks, missing shingles, or sagging areas. It’s also important to evaluate the style and materials that match the home’s architecture and meet local building codes. Understanding the overall process, including potential disruptions and maintenance during installation, can help homeowners plan accordingly. Clear communication about project scope and expectations ensures a smooth transition to a new, reliable roof.

Common Residential Roof Replacement Jobs
Residential Roof Replacement - involves removing and replacing an aging or damaged roof to restore protection.
Asphalt shingle roof replacement - commonly requested for durability and aesthetic appeal in residential homes.
Tile roof replacement - suitable for homeowners seeking a long-lasting and distinctive roofing option.
Metal roof replacement - offers increased lifespan and resistance to harsh weather conditions.
Flat roof replacement - designed for homes with flat or low-slope roofs needing reliable waterproofing.
Complete roof overhaul - addresses extensive damage or upgrades to improve energy efficiency and curb appeal.
Residential Roof Replacement Questions
What are signs that a ro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as missing shingles, extensive leaks, or widespread wear indicate a roof may need replacement.
How does a roof replacement benefit a home? It enhances curb appeal, improves energy efficiency, and provides long-term protection against weather elements.
What types of roofing materials are commonly used? Asphalt shingles, metal panels, and architectural shingles are popular options for residential roof replacements.
What should property owners consider before replacing a roof? Assessing the roof’s condition, choosing suitable materials, and understanding the scope of work are important steps.
